About this event
The joy of working in mixed media is all the unexpected effects you discover while experimenting with a variety of media and mark making.
Learn how to build up layers of colour and texture to create complex and interesting surfaces. Using paint, oil pastel, pencil, textiles & paper to collage, draw, scrape, stamp and stencil, you will let each layer guide you to the next and you’ll discover how to make those “what should I do next” decisions. Annie usually works in abstract, but the techniques can be utilised to paint any subject in new and exciting ways. You'll be shown tips & tricks and be advised & guided, but overall it will be a day of play & discovery and you'll leave with a mind brimming with ideas.
You can create totally free-form from your imagination or bring some favourite images to use for reference if you prefer.

Historic Settlers Cottage is located at 180 Pearson Street, Churchlands, is owned by the National Trust and currently used as Art Studios. The setting is idyllic, nestled close to the Herdsman Lake, surrounded by trees and wildlife. The venue for our workshops is in the adjacent Shelter area (outdoor undercover with weather protection) and on the shady verandahs of the cottage.
